  2. OT is probably the teams biggest need moving forward. Moton on his last legs, gonna be gone soon. Ickey's injury is really nasty and has a very low success rate. Most likely he never returns to form 100%. Walker is just a one year band-aid. In today's NFL you need two good OTs and they have ZERO long term answers. If Bryce flames out, then you're forced to use the 1st next year on a QB (and possibly 2nd rounder to trade up). And then what? You drop your new top pick QB in behind an OLine with zero OTs, two aging guards and whoever ends up playing center? Total disaster. Given that Freeling was considered a top 15 pick by most, easy decision here. Not flashy or exciting but it's the right move.
